Output 2efcd704729bb94206129cb810c9f77057757ec2c3ff5f39fa8618759c4b5ec3:11

value
66824362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1ce04feb41b08619a7663ea3e99fcbdca9777e OP_EQUAL
address
MN3KZX3WoyGHJ4UVy1n5B7Are859scavUN
transaction
2efcd704729bb94206129cb810c9f77057757ec2c3ff5f39fa8618759c4b5ec3
spent
true